BACKGROUND: The aim of this study was to evaluate the predictive value of the hematological parameters in the identification of human cytomegalovirus (CMV) infection in infants less than 3 months.Entities:

Hematological parameters of the CMV infection group and control group
| Blood routine test | CMV infection group ( | Control group ( |
|
|---|---|---|---|
| WBC (109/L) | 10.95 ± 4.38 | 9.77 ± 3.18 |
|
| NEU (109/L) | 2.30 ± 1.78 | 2.79 ± 1.61 |
|
| LYM (109/L) | 6.92 ± 3.09 | 5.27 ± 1.72 |
|
| MON (109/L) | 1.31 ± 0.63 | 1.27 ± 0.56 | 0.483 |
| PLT (109/L) | 324.35 ± 125.49 | 380.93 ± 119.35 |
|
| HB (g/dl) | 11.40 ± 2.17 | 12.00 ± 2.22 |
|
| NLR | 0.37 ± 0.31 | 0.56 ± 0.34 |
|
| PLR | 54.69 ± 29.57 | 79.03 ± 34.68 |
|
| LMR | 5.98 ± 2.85 | 4.79 ± 2.91 |
|
Abbreviations: CMV, cytomegalovirus; HB, hemoglobin; LMR, lymphocyte‐to‐monocyte; LYM, lymphocyte; MON, monocyte; NEU, neutrophil; NLR, neutrophil‐to‐lymphocyte; PLR, platelet‐to‐lymphocyte; PLT, platelet; WBC, white blood cell count.
p‐value <0.05 marked in bold font shows statistical significance.

Areas under the ROC curves of NLR, PLR, and NLR‐PLR score for predicting CMV infection
| Variables | Area under the ROC curve (95% CI) |
|
|---|---|---|
| NLR (≤0.28/>0.28) | 0.689 (0.636–0.743) |
|
| PLR (≤65.36/>65.36) | 0.689 (0.636–0.743) |
|
| NLR‐PLR score (0/1/2) | 0.760 (0.712–0.809) |
|
Abbreviations: CMV, cytomegalovirus; NLR, neutrophil‐to‐lymphocyte; PLR, platelet‐to‐lymphocyte; ROC, receiver‐operating characteristic.
p‐value <0.05 marked in bold font shows statistical significance.
FIGURE 3Comparison of area under the receiver‐operating characteristic curve (AUC) in different inflammation‐based scores. NLR‐PLR score for CMV infection prediction yielded higher AUC values than NLR or PLR alone
